Gaza Sky Geeks (GSG) is Gaza’s leading co-working space, tech education hub, and startup accelerator, run by Mercy Corps, a nonprofit international relief and development organization with programs in the occupied Palestinian territories since the 1980s. Mercy Corps founded GSG in partnership with Google.org in 2011. We bring together online freelancers, outsourcers, and startup founders together under one roof to share ideas, best practices, code, and build brighter futures through the power of the internet. Gaza Sky Geeks’ overarching goal is to build an internationally competitive technology ecosystem in Gaza through online freelancing, outsourcing, and startups.

The Code Academy Career Accelerator  

For the next Career Accelerator program, we are changing the structure of our staff, and are looking for a senior, experienced developer to teach the technical content course. The instructor will be reporting to, and working very closely with, the Career Accelerator Lead, Ahmed Ajour, who will be leading the cohort, and responsible for its overall success.

Unlike in previous cohorts, where the course delivery has been mostly done by fresh graduates, with the support of a course facilitator, for the next cohort (starting in May), the instructor will be delivering most of the content, and the graduate mentors will be in the supporting role.

We feel that this will be beneficial for both the students on the course, and also for the mentors, who will have less pressure on them during their time mentoring, and will be able to revise and solidify their knowledge more easily. The graduate mentors will certainly still play a role in helping the students on the course, but they will not be expected to deliver workshops, unless they volunteer to, and the instructor agrees.
